Our Programs

We are a growing school of approximately 300 students with a beautiful campus in Bowness, Calgary, Alberta.

We operate with low pupil-teacher ratio, maximizing instructional time and the personalization of learning for students Age 3 to Grade 6. Drawing from the best educational pedagogies, we foster each child’s inherent intellectual and creative potential, while fulfilling their innate desire to learn – in a nurturing and innovative environment. It is an enquiry-based, student-centred program where learning is hands-on, contextual and centred around big ideas and questions that engage our students.

With our Before & After School programs, River Valley School offers a safe, caring environment for children ages 3 to grade 6 from 7 AM to 6 PM Mondays through Fridays year-round. We also offer Bussing Services to our students that service specific communities in the SW, Central and NW quadrants of the city.

Early Learning Programs

Ages 3 – 5 (Tots, Junior Kindergarten & Kindergarten)

Our Early Learning programs include Tots (3-year-olds), Junior Kindergarten (4-year-olds) and Kindergarten (5-year-olds). All of our littlest students participate in hands-on, inquiry and play-based learning in core academic areas as well as exposure to French, Music, Phys. Ed, Library and Outdoor Education. Kindergarten students also work with Art and Drama specialists to unleash their true creative potential. It is a great introduction to school with a perfect balance of academics, play, creativity and exploration!

Tots (3-year-old Program)

  • Part-Time: Mondays, Wednesdays & Fridays
  • Half-Day: Monday to Friday
  • Full-Day: Monday to Friday

Junior Kindergarten (4-year-old Program)

  • Full-Time: Monday to Friday

Kindergarten (5-year-old Program)

  • Full-Time: Monday to Friday

Elementary Programs

Grades 1 – 6

Our Elementary students are immersed in inquiry and project based learning experiences that challenge them to question, explore and create. Our curriculum and activities are grounded in design thinking, which provides students with a ‘road map’ to identify challenges, gather information, generate ideas, and test solutions. In addition to core subjects, students enjoy enriched programming in Music, French, Art, Health, Drama, Physical and Outdoor Education, Library, and STEAM (Science, Technology, Engineering, Arts and Mathematics).

A Day in the Life

The Arrowsmith Program

The Arrowsmith Program is an optional program within River Valley School that is geared specifically towards our Grade 1-6 students with identified learning disabilities and/or learning challenges.

Our Arrowsmith certified teachers focus on the science of Neuroplasticity to retrain the brain and give students the tools they need to succeed in the classroom and in life. River Valley School is the only school in Alberta that offers the Arrowsmith Program. There is a full or part-time option available in this program.

Curious if this program is right for your child? Contact admissions@rivervalleyschool.ca or BOOK A TOUR TODAY!